Solution Overview

Problem

Next-generation mobile communication systems require efficient allocation and processing of a large number of transmission resources to support high data transfer rates and short delay response times, necessitating the distribution and configuration of data across multiple logical channels.

Innovation Solution

A method and apparatus for allocating and configuring transmission resources by identifying data units corresponding to logical channels, determining their sizes based on allocated resources, and transmitting data accordingly, allowing for pre-processing before resource allocation.

The present disclosure relates to a communication method and system for converging a 5th-Generation (5G) communication system for supporting higher data rates beyond a 4th-Generation (4G) system with a technology for Internet of Things (IoT). The present disclosure may be applied to intelligent services based on the 5G communication technology and the IoT-related technology, such as smart home, smart building, smart city, smart car, connected car, health care, digital education, smart retail, security and safety services. A method for transmitting information in a communication system is provided. The method includes receiving information for allocating at least two transmission resources, allocating at least two transmission resources, identifying a data unit corresponding to at least one logical channel, determining a size of the data unit, which is to be transmitted based on a size of the allocated at least two transmission resources, and transmitting data to a receiver based on the determined size of the data unit.
